Current Tags for This Pattern / bead / Black / Ice Dub / olive / Precursor![]() tied by uncletube Fly Type: Attractor Pattern, Target Species: Trout, Recommended Region: Central US, Imitation: Mayflies, Material List*: Hook: dai-riki #270 size 14 to 18 Bead: small black (I use a 7/64 for 18's and 16's) Thread: 8/0 light olive unithread Tail: a few wisps of black hen hackle Body: Light Olive V Rib (small) Thorax; Black Ice Dub Hackle; 2 turns of Black hen hackle *Materials with links give you direct access to that product at the J. Stockard store. Tying Instructions: tie in the tail just a little bit into the bend of the hook to give the fly a slight bend.tie in the v-rib. Wrap forward to just shyf the bead. form a small noodle of black ice dubbing and form the thorax. tie in the hackle and make 2 turns. whip finish Presentation Tips: Dead drift in riffles and along weed beeds | Other Flies Tied by uncletube Members That Bookmarked This Fly Also Bookmarked...
